Product Description:
The ZW20-12(F) Outdoor Vacuum Circuit Breaker is a versatile and intelligent device that combines the functions of a vacuum breaker, vacuum load switch, recloser, and sectionalizer. It is designed for use in 10kV and 13kV distribution networks, specifically in city and rural power grids.
The main components of the ZW20-12(F) circuit breaker include a vacuum breaker, CH-40 controller, and an external voltage transformer. The vacuum breaker is responsible for interrupting and making electrical circuits, while the CH-40 controller provides intelligent protection and control functions. The external voltage transformer helps in accurate voltage measurement for control and monitoring purposes.
The GW9-10 high voltage disconnect switch is an electrical switch that is designed to isolate a section of an electrical network or system from the rest of the system for maintenance or repair purposes. It is typically used in high voltage power transmission and distribution systems.
The switch is designed to open and close under normal or abnormal conditions, such as a fault or overcurrent. When the switch is open, it physically disconnects the section of the system from the rest of the network, preventing the flow of electricity to that section.
High voltage disconnect switches are typically designed to operate at voltages between 600 volts and 765,000 volts, and they can be operated manually or automatically. They are typically installed in substations or on power poles, and they are an important component of the electrical grid infrastructure.

Application:
1.Disconnecting Switch and Contact Switch: The ZW20-12(F) circuit breaker can be used as a disconnecting switch or contact switch in the ring network configuration of power distribution systems. It enables the opening and closing of circuits during maintenance or fault conditions.
2.Automatic Switch Device: It serves as an automatic switch device, allowing for the implementation of load switching in the ring network configuration. This feature enhances the flexibility and efficiency of power distribution.
3.Boundary Switch: In branch lines of the power supply, the ZW20-12(F) circuit breaker can function as a boundary switch or "watchdog." It helps in monitoring and protecting the branch line against faults and abnormal conditions.
4.Recloser and Sectionalizer: The circuit breaker can operate as a recloser and sectionalizer in overhead distribution networks. It automatically restores power after temporary faults and isolates faulty sections to minimize the impact of outages.
Structure:
1.The controller is a microcomputer-based relay protection and monitoring device.
2.The controller has strong weather resistance and protection against condensation.
3.It is connected to the switch body through aviation connectors.
4.It has good connection reliability and a high protection level.
The controller has four input analog channels: Phase A current, Phase C current, zero-sequence current, and Phase BC voltage. The controller monitors the values of these analog inputs in real-time and compares them with set values to determine line faults and initiate corresponding actions.
